2009-04-21から1日間の記事一覧

ナカガブログ: 大学におけるソフトウエア教育の実例 =中編=

これより、金田教授の発表をお聞きしての、私の感想に移ります。 Ruby On RAILS、Javaで記述するシステムの開発支援ツールeclipse などが登場するに至って、システム利用予定者の言い分を、それなりに稼働させることは、以前に比べ、飛躍的に容易になったこ…

RESTful Webサービス - 発声練習

RESTful WebサービスRuby on Railsを使ってWebアプリケーションを作りたいと思ったのだけど、Ruby on Railsの1.2からRESTfulなアプリケーションの作成を支援するツールになったらしいので、読んでみた。RESTfulアーキテクチャやリソース指向アーキテクチャの…

Rails勉強会@東京第40回にいってきた - ayumin’s blog

Ruby, 勉強会 | 00:08前半セッション - Merb on GAE/j(Google App Engine)Merb AppおGAE/jで動かすお話。詳しくは↓http://d.hatena.ne.jp/hs9587/20090419後半セッション - RSpecとかテストとかview のテストはかくの? →かく。Rspecでかく →conrollerで仕事…

Postfix + Rails で空メール対応 - 夜の Discovery

ruby, rails, action_mailer, postfixここで言う空メールとは携帯からメールを送ると、会員登録用の URL を書いたメールが自動返信されてくるアレのことです。 仕様としては reg@example.com へ空メールを送ると会員登録 URL を書いたメールが自動返信されて…

require_fix.rb 最新版 - Hello, world! - s21g JRubyで相対パスを含む場合に、Jarファイルの中のファイルを読めるようにするためのモンキーパッチの最新版です。1 def cleanup_path(path)2 if path.to_s.match(/^file:/) && path.is_a?(String)3 jar_path, …

System.Exit - Sinatra が Google App Engine で動くまで

(注: Google App Engine を GAE と略すことがあります。)Sinatra を Google App Engine で動かしてみました。Github にすぐに動かせるものを置いておいたので、手っ取り早く試したい人はここからソースを取ってきて動かしてみるといいと思います。 appengi…

Google Analyticsで同じURLのページの遷移のデータを取得する方法

DoRuby! (ドルビー!) は現場のエンジニアによる、主にRubyなどの技術に関する様々な実践ノウハウを集めた技術情報サイトです。Google Analtyicsで同じURLの遷移のデータを取得する方法 アクセス解析チーム中林です。 Google Analyticsを使用していてコンバー…

ラス・オルセン『Rubyによるデザインパターン』 - 思っているよりもずっとずっと人生は短い。

Rubyによるデザイン・パターン作者: Russ Olsen, ラス・オルセン, 小林健一, 菅野裕, 吉野雅人, 山岸夢人, 小島努出版社/メーカー: ピアソンエデュケーション発売日: 2009/04/24メディア: 単行本(ソフトカバー)Rubyのデザパタ本はたぶんこれが初めてのはず…

B木の Copy-Modify 方式での実験的コード - Tociyuki::Diary

id:naoya さんの Python 版B木に触発されて、Ruby 版の insert・delete だけを実装した B 木を書いてみました。実装にあたり、標準的な教科書に良く掲載されている Overwrite 方式ではなく、現代的な Copy-Modify 方式、すなわち B 木の葉から根に向かって更…

エンタープライズRuby環境、軽量WebサーバNginxに対応 | エンタープライズ | マイコミジャーナル

Phusion Passenger for NginxPhusionはPhusion Passengerの最新版となるPhusion Passenger 2.2.0を公開した。なお公開してすぐにバグが発見されたため、数日後に修正版となる2.2.1が公開されている。Phusion Passengerをインストールした場合、バージョンが2…

hibariya.org | Ubuntuのrubygemsをrubygems1.3にアップデート

UbuntuでRails環境を構築したかったけど手間取った。 必要な環境は、Ruby1.8.7, Rails2.2.2。 ・まずは普通にrubyとgemを入れて、バージョンを指定してRailsをインストール % sudo aptitude install ruby1.8 rubygems1.8 ruby% sudo gem install rails --inc…

Rails 2.x で携帯サービスを作るときの注意点 - 夜の Discovery

rails, ruby, mobile最近、携帯サービスを作っていて、いろいろ出てきたのでまとめてみます。 私的重要度順。新しめの au 携帯では formatted_route(xml)が優先される。DoCoMo, au には RFC 違反のメールアドレスが存在し、ActionMailer(TMail)をそのまま…

Rails2.3.2でiso-2022-jpのメールを送りつつテストも通るようにしてみた

KBMJ谷です。昨年の5月以来…。今回はRails2.3.2で、テストコードを書きつつ(ここがミソ)、iso-2022-jpのメールを送ってみます。o- 今回の環境OS : Linux(ubuntu-server 8.10)@VitrulBox2.1.4 on WinXP SP3Ruby : 1.8.7 (2008-08-11 patchlevel 72) [i686-lin…